2025 Ford Mustang review
I’ve owned my Mustang EcoBoost Premium Convertible for a while now, and it completely shatters the old stereotype that a Mustang needs a V8 to be a "real" sports car. It is the perfect platform for someone who wants open-air fun without sacrificing premium comfort, daily drivability, or cutting-edge technology. The stock EcoBoost engine is already incredibly punchy, but the platform reacts beautifully to the right modifications. Adding the Ford Performance Calibration—which ups the output to a serious 350 horsepower and 402 lb-ft of torque—along with a Mishimoto intercooler completely wakes the car up. To be honest, this is exactly how the car should have come from the factory if Ford wasn't so worried about tuning it down just to keep it 87-octane compatible. Running it on premium fuel with this calibration gives you massive low-end torque, immediate throttle response around town, and a relentless pull on the highway. Opting for the Premium trim is a must. The interior materials are a massive step up, making the cabin feel like a high-end grand tourer. I am especially happy with the tech in this car. I absolutely love the giant digital screen layout. While some Mustang purists don't like it and prefer old-school physical gauges, I am someone who always embraces new technology. Sitting in the driver's seat makes me feel like I am in an airplane cockpit. Features like the active cruise control work excellently on longer drives. The only thing I wish Ford had included in this tech package is a Head-Up Display (HUD). Because it's a convertible, you do have to deal with open-air road noise, and while the factory B&O sound system is decent, to me it was really lacking—especially with the top down. Fortunately, the platform is incredibly rewarding if you like to customize, so I upgraded the factory audio to a custom, high-end 3-way active system while retaining the stock head unit. Now, even with the top down on the highway, the audio clarity is absolutely incredible. If you are looking for a sharp, tech-forward sports car that delivers genuine performance, upscale daily comfort, and a brilliant platform for subtle, high-quality upgrades, the EcoBoost Premium Convertible is tough to beat.

2023 Ford F-150 review
2023 F150 Lariat. Just bought this used so these are my first impressions. So far very happy with the truck. Comfortable and handles nicely. V-6 seems very responsive. My issues at this point are related to my ability to setup this truck the way I want it. I am lucky that it came with the feature for automatic shutoff every time you stop for a red light already permanently removed. I would hate that feature if it had it. There is a lot of other features I would just as soon not have that I have had varying levels of success in turning off. Automatic lane keeping is one. While I was able to turn it off in the settings, it still interferes with setting cruise control. When I try to turn cruise control on it sets lane keeping anyway and I have to turn it off with another button press, while showing a stupid truck icon on the dash instead of my speed. I have to press an OK button to turn lane keeping off, then it will set the cruise control. All these button presses and having to look at the dash while doing this are very distracting and increases the time I'm not looking at the road, actually making the truck less safe. You really have to pick your time for setting cruise control. The automatic braking is another dangerous feature in my view. Thankfully I was able to turn that one off. The truck will beep 2 times if the engine is running and you get out, like to check your mailbox. It is irritating at best, not just for me, but for my neighbors, especially early in the morning or late at night. There is no mute button on the steering wheel for the radio, that I can find at least. I had this feature on other trucks and found it very helpful. Reverse brake assist makes no sense to me at all. I turned it off, but it is another one that puts a warning message on the dash to tell me that. I find the warning messages for the features I have turned off distracting and useless. These are my first impressions, there will probably be more later.

2019 Ford F-250 review
I got my crew cab 2019 F250 XLT with the 6.2L for 37k in 2020 with 22k miles on it. I’ve put 25k miles on it in two years and It’s been ok, the cab is very spacious, first thing people say when they open the back doors is “this thing is a limo!” And trust me it’s the best thing for moving. I love the fold up backseats, it’s just that much more cargo space. Mine also has the pop up organizer under the seat which is perfect for grocery shopping, and keeping tools from rolling around. She’s pretty quick for her size too which I enjoy, I’ve had no running issues yet but honestly I’m not impressed with its Towing capabilities. I had my older 7200lb superduty on a trailer and the 2019 seemed to have a hard time figuring out what gear it wanted to be in even with tow mode on while doing 30-40mph. Between that, the heat shield breaking drive shafts recall, and the death wobble I’m sad to say I’m a bit scared of how reliable this thing will be in the long term. I have mine on the list for a new steering dampener to fix it’s death wobble but parts are back ordered “could be 2 weeks or 6 months” the dealership told me. Luckily Ford will cover it cuz it’s a widespread known issue tho. I love the ride and the space, but the mpg is killing me at 15mpg when my 2000 f250 also gets 12-15! 19 years of improvements for the same fuel mileage? Kind of pathetic! My 2000 is just a better truck even with the smaller 5.4L. when it comes to hauling, towing and yanking trees out of the ground the old girl takes the cake!

2023 Ford F-150 review
A little choppy on dirt roads, feel the uneven paved road surfaces. I attribute this to the 4X4 suspension. Excellent payload , 1865 lbs.for the non-turbo 3.3 liter which has been stellar performer in 35K miles. I average 24mpg all weather. Very good drive modes, sport kicks it up to V8 feel, shift on the fly seamless. Handles great with loads 1000 lbs. plus. Hot riding vinyl seats are sport like hugging you, difficult to turn around to look out the back window. I don't rely solely on back up camera because it does hide the corners where pedestrians are. Confining driving position barely allows for my 6 foot frame. Seats belong in a sports car, not a truck! I should have got the cloth seats! The cab lacks much space behind seats for a small cooler of water or duffel bag. The transmission was clunky in the first 4 months. I think it was the computer adjusting for driving habits. The 12" touch screen has many features and can be turned off. Integrated phone is easy set up, Personal music can be played or built in music apps. The maps are great showing satellite view and North South configuration based on direction view. Service often freezes when you get in valleys. The worst feature is vehicle manual on computer, takes 10x longer to find what you are looking for. Ask Ford to order a printed booklet! The instrument panel is well laid out however the steering wheel sometimes obstructs information. The tilt, telescope wheel is perfect for shorter drivers. There are many cluster views to choose from and two trip odometers, a big plus. I choose one layout for all driving. Took a long time to get used to where radio controls are as I was always turning down the blower motor switch. Blower motor has 8 speeds and whisper quiet up to 5. Also has an ac booster for quick cab cooling, heat, nice! The stereo has equalizer, 4 speakers and will blow out your ear drums unless you have deafness. I find the adjustments for instrument brightness, headlights, fog, and bed lights to be very awkward, An afterthought by Ford engineers? Placed at lower left below segregated instrument layout. Needs to be easily visible, not hidden from view and adjustment. The high beams light up the next county and 50 feet up the treeline. Not sure I need to see owls in the trees, but I can. The flash to pass feature needs to be more blinks, changing lanes that fast is dangerous. The windshield is large and raked offering a full road view and pillars don't obstruct the roadway. The rear view camera can be used while driving and shows tailgaters. The rear window has defrost, tint. The tint is great but defrost is imo a dumb idea. Window easily defrosts with heat or defogs with ac. This isn't a car! I chose Ford over competition because my last F150 gave me 400K, never left me stranded, had a great V6, super good tranny and decent fuel mileage. I like the payload, handling, maps and my music from my apps. I like the aluminum clad where my last steel truck started rusting everywhere. The weight is nimble feel while driving, almost sporty on twisty roadways with very good acceleration and quicker stopping. The cost of ownership is less than foreign and many domestic. I have no recalls in 2 years. I drive in snow often, the handling and my confidence level are excellent but I still have weight in the bed for traction since this is 700 lbs. lighter than my 2013. Overall, I like this vehicle very much and look forward to a new one, better designed or upgraded 2028.

2020 Ford Escape review
I bought a used 2020 Ford escape hybrid titanium with 33,000 miles. I came from a 2015 X3 and I am surprised how well this car handles and feels firmly planted. I love the electric driving at slow speeds and you can hear the gas engine come on and it’s louder than my BMW, but I am still pleasantly surprised by the low level of road noise at highway speeds. Mine is Persian green, which is rare, and absolutely beautiful after I waxed it. The exterior is pretty good, considering its price range, and the interior is subpar with the hard plastic on the doors, but overall, the controls are very intuitive, easily reachable, and after I learned how to use all the options, my favorite feature is the adaptive cruise control with stop and go and lane centering. The car basically just drives itself, even in the city at low speeds. I just have to make the turns and stop at red lights and stop signs if there is no car in front of me. I also love the short stopping distances with the brakes, which feel great and confidence-inspiring, and the steering actually feels better than in my BMW, which was too light at highway speeds. Another feature that sold me was how much legroom there is in the backseat, especially the fact that you can recline the backseat a little bit and also push it a few inches back to create more legroom. There is definitely more legroom in the front and back than in my BMW, even though my BMW was a few inches longer than this car. I love the look of the RAV4 hybrid XLE and it has more cargo room, but if you check the user reviews, you’ll see that the Escape hybrid actually beats it in mpg and in my area, I would’ve paid $8k - $9k more for a similar used RAV4 so I felt like the Escape hybrid was a better value overall. I rarely buy extended warranties with cars, but I did with this one since it was such a good deal at only $4000 but it gave me seven years of extended coverage and up to 80,000 more miles, whichever comes first. Considering how tariffs will affect car part pricing and car repair bills, I thought this was a an exceptional value, just like the car itself. I’ve only had it for three weeks, but I am really enjoying driving the car and seeing how little gas it sips.

Which Ford vehicle has the best MPG?
The Ford Fusion Hybrid can reach up to 44 MPG city and 41 MPG highway for a combined rating of 42 MPG. The Ford Maverick with traditional internal combustion engine offers up to 42 MPG city and 35 MPG highway for a combined rating of 38 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le model year, tr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
Which Ford vehicle has the longest range?
The electric Ford F-150 Lightning can travel up to 320 miles on a single charge depending on electric motor and battery options. The plug-in hybrid Ford Escape PHEV can travel up to 37 electric-only miles before the gas engine kicks on.
EPA-estimated range is the distance, or predicted distance, a new plug-in vehicle will travel on electric power before its battery charge is exhausted. Actual range will vary depending on model year, driving conditions, driving habits, elevation changes, weather, accessory usage (lights, climate control), vehicle condition and other factors.
